**Job Title:** Program Manager, Innovation
**Location:** Covington, GA
**Department:** UCC Innovation
**Reports To:** Wanfei Yang
**Job Summary:**
We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ced Program Manager to join our UCC Innovation team and lead Acute Care Innovation activities. The successful candidate will manage the innovation funnel for Acute Care, driving cross-functional efforts to identify unmet needs and advance prioritized projects. This role requires a strategic thinker with a passion for innovation and a proven track record in Biodesign and product development.
**Key Responsibilities:**
_Oversees the Health of the Acute Care Innovation Funnel:_
+ Collaborate with cross-functional and cross-regional teams to identify unmet needs and continuously fill the innovation funnel.
+ Coordinate input for the quarterly refresh of the Acute Care innovation roadmap in close partnership with Marketing, PDL, and Medical Affairs teams.
+ Host monthly platform reviews on innovation to ensure alignment on priorities, provide critical project updates, and share insights.
_Leads Critical Acute Care Projects:_
+ Serve as the project lead for 2-3 critical innovation projects, supporting the team to practice according to the BD Innovation Playbook.
+ Conduct comprehensive transfers of projects to Product Development for seamless implementation in Acute Care.
_Drives Strong Innovation Culture at UCC:_
+ **Training:** Coordinate innovation-related training events to empower UCC’s innovation engine.
+ **Mentorship:** Mentor engineers and cross-functional associates on Biodesign principles and drive a culture of innovation at UCC.
+ **Bring Gemba to UCC:** Conduct field visits and attend conferences to establish a deep understanding of customers, and bring insights back to the UCC business.

**Requirements:**
+ BA/BS required, advanced degree in Science or Engineering; commercial or clinical experience is a bonus.
+ 4+ years' of program or management in a medical device or regulated industry required
+ Extensive training in Biodesign, Design Thinking, or Design for Six Sigma (DFSS) required
**Qualifications:**
+ Experience in innovation or creative product development processes.
+ Demonstrated ability to lead complex cross-functional initiatives.
+ Demonstrated ability to develop deep, rigorous analytical analysis that drives growth opportunity identification, strategy development, or technology/product decision-making.
+ Demonstrated ability to independently identify, prioritize, and successfully advocate for opportunities to drive growth.
